1. A cutting machine for the chip-removing machining of a workpiece, which chip-removing machining takes place in a chronological sequence of manufacturing steps by using several required tools; wherein in each manufacturing step a required tool can exert a tool force onto the workpiece in a force main direction; the cutting machine comprising:
a tool holder configured for holding the required tools all at the same time, wherein the tool holder defines a plurality of recesses and at least one cavity;
a plurality of signal lines and a signal socket connected to the tool holder,
a tool slide configured for moving the tool holder so that one of the required tools can be aligned with a workpiece and the required tool and the workpiece can be moved with respect to each other for chip-removing machining in each manufacturing step;
wherein the tool holder includes a first fastening means and a second fastening means;
wherein the tool holder is fastened to the tool slide via the first fastening means and via the second fastening means;
wherein the tool holder fastened to the tool slide is spaced apart from the tool slide by a gap proximate the plurality of recesses;
wherein the tool holder includes at least two single-component force transducers;
wherein each of the at least two single-component force transducers is configured to measure a tool force exerted by one of the required tools during the chip-removing machining of a workpiece in the force main direction;
wherein each of the single-component force transducers is inserted into a respective one of the plurality of recesses;
wherein each of the single-component force transducers is electrically connected to the signal socket via a respective one of the plurality of signal lines;
wherein the plurality of signal lines is introduced into the cavity;
wherein the tool holder defines a plurality of first housing end faces and a plurality of second housing end faces; and
wherein the single-component force transducers inserted into the plurality of recesses are in planar contact to the tool slide via the second housing end faces proximate the recesses.
